Global Vegetable Oils Production Share by Country (Thousand Metric Tons)

The global vegetable oils production landscape is dominated by Indonesia, contributing significantly more than any other country, followed by China, Malaysia, and the United States. The production share varies with significant yearly changes such as in Argentina, Canada, and Colombia, which experienced notable increases. Conversely, countries like Germany, Netherlands, and the Philippines saw declines.
